Course Overview

This course provides an introduction to the fundamentals of accounting, focusing on the purpose and structure of accounting records. Participants will understand why financial reporting standards are essential, ensuring clarity, consistency, and transparency in financial communication. The session lays the foundation for understanding how accounting information supports decision-making and organisational transparency.
